MARCH 11 - IN THE HISTORY Calender Search
 
2006
In Lahore, Pakistan, hundreds of kites filled the skies on the opening day of a traditional spring festival, despite a ban that followed the deaths of seven people killed by glass-coated or wire kite strings.
2006
In Sudan 5 members of the main opposition group in eastern Sudan were arrested or detained, in a move party officials said hindered any chance to start long-delayed peace talks.
2006
Turkish and Kurdish intellectuals gathered under tight security for a major 2-day conference in Istanbul to discuss a peaceful resolution to the 22-year-old Kurdish conflict.

2006
Zimbabwe’s Central Statistical Office said inflation was 782 percent for the 12 months that ended in February. Moffat Nyoni, acting director of the government-run Statistical Office, said prices of food and nonalcoholic beverages rose 824 percent during that time.
